What the numbers say
Resideline tracked 489 closed sales in Martinsburg over the last six months, with a median closing price of $315,000. That median is the midpoint of what buyers actually paid, not what sellers hoped to get, which is why it moves differently from the asking prices you see on listing sites. These are the closings we track, not a complete county record, so treat the count as a large sample of the market rather than every sale that happened.

The Martinsburg angle
Martinsburg anchors West Virginia's Eastern Panhandle and connects to the Washington area by MARC commuter rail, which pulls in buyers who work well outside the state. We tracked 489 closings over six months at a median of $315,000. The older core holds nineteenth-century brick and stone housing tied to the town's railroad past, while newer subdivisions have filled in along the Interstate 81 corridor. A midpoint of $315,000 is a substantial step down from the Virginia and Maryland markets many of those commuters are leaving. Half of the tracked closings landed above that figure.
